Perbezaan Antara G-WAN dan Nginx

Pengarang: Monica Porter
Tarikh Penciptaan: 22 Mac 2021
Tarikh Kemas Kini: 4 Mungkin 2024
Anonim
Perbezaan Antara G-WAN dan Nginx - Cara Hidup
Perbezaan Antara G-WAN dan Nginx - Cara Hidup

Kandungan

Perbezaan Utama

Kedua-dua G-WAN (freeware) dan Nginx (open-source) adalah pelayan HTTP untuk Linux dan Windows. Kedua-duanya bermaksud "ringan" dan "cepat". Projek Nginx bermula pada tahun 2004 manakala G-WAN bermula pada tahun 2009. G-WAN berjalan sebagai satu proses tunggal dengan thread per CPU fizikal (atau Core). Nginx berjalan sebagai proses induk dan beberapa proses pekerja. Umur Nginx kurang fleksibel berbanding dengan G-Wan.


Apa itu G-WAN?

G-WAN berjalan C, C # atau Java dengan kurang CPU dan kurang RAM ketika mengendalikan lebih banyak permintaan daripada server lain. Bahasa lain (Pergi, PHP, Python, Ruby, JS ...) mendapat manfaat daripada seni bina multicore G-WAN. G-WAN menyokong HTTP 1.1, tetapi pengendali protokolnya lebih fleksibel dan menjadikannya lebih mudah untuk memasangkan perpustakaan pihak ketiga, sebilangan besar protokol telah dilaksanakan, seperti SCGI, DNS (TCP dan UDP), SMTP dan POP3, beberapa pangkalan data dan pelayan kunci / nilai, dan juga VPN.

Apa itu Nginx?

NGINX adalah hati rahsia web moden, yang memberikan 1 dari 3 tapak dan aplikasi tersibuk di dunia. Projek sumber terbuka NGINX bermula pada tahun 2002 dan telah berkembang pesat dalam tempoh 10 tahun yang lalu. Kini, berjuta-juta inovator memilih NGINX untuk menyampaikan laman dan aplikasi mereka dengan prestasi, kebolehpercayaan, keselamatan, dan skala.

Perbezaan Utama

  1. G-WAN berjalan sebagai satu proses tunggal dengan thread untuk CPU fizikal (atau Core). Nginx berjalan sebagai proses induk dan beberapa proses pekerja.
  2. Pengedaran pasaran G-WAN tidak diketahui tetapi mungkin jauh di bawah 1%, yang selaras dengan pasaran Nginx pada usia yang sama (laman web dan dokumentasi Nginx diterjemahkan selepas penggunaan "sulit" terhad 5 tahun ke pasaran Rusia).
  3. G-WAN bertujuan untuk menjadi super cepat tanpa konfigurasi, sambil menawarkan skrip "edit & play" dalam Asm, C, C ++, C #, D, Go, Java, JavaScript, Lua, Objective-C, Perl, PHP, Python, Ruby dan Scala (dan kedai kunci, pelanggan, GIF I / O, lukisan 2D, carta dan sparklines, crypto, RNGs ...) yang mungkin kelihatan agak pemaju berorientasikan untuk pereka Web tetapi yang akan menjadi pemrogram - sasaran penonton oleh G-WAN. Sebaliknya, Nginx mempunyai banyak ciri pelayan Web tradisional (seperti pelbagai fail konfigurasi dan modul kompleks) yang lebih menargetkan Master Web daripada pemaju Web.
  4. Nginx menyokong HTTP 1.1 dan SPDY dan pelaksanaan draf HTTP 2.0 melalui modul khusus Nginx.
  5. G-WAN juga menyokong HTTP 1.1, tetapi pengendali protokolnya lebih fleksibel dan menjadikannya lebih mudah untuk memasangkan perpustakaan pihak ketiga, sebilangan besar protokol telah dilaksanakan, seperti SCGI, DNS (TCP dan UDP), SMTP dan POP3 , beberapa pangkalan data dan pelayan kunci / nilai, dan juga VPN.
  6. Nginx, walaupun umurnya kurang fleksibel berbanding dengan G-Wan.
  7. Nginx, yang dua kali lebih tua daripada G-WAN, telah dengan cepat meningkatkan pangsa pasarnya setelah pengasas DELL Computers melabur dalam syarikat komersial "Nginx Inc". Walaupun statistik berbeza bergantung kepada syarikat mengukur pasaran, Nginx kini digunakan oleh kira-kira 37.7% daripada laman web mengikut Suruhanjaya Perkhidmatan Web April 2014
  8. Menggunakan reka bentuk yang berbeza berdasarkan benang dan peristiwa, G-WAN lebih ringan dan lebih cepat daripada pelayan arus perdana, fakta yang disahkan secara bebas oleh beberapa penanda aras pihak ketiga sejak bertahun-tahun.

Semak vs Semak - Apa perbezaannya?

Monica Porter

Mungkin 2024

emak Cek, atau cek (Bahaa Inggeri Amerika; lihat perbezaan ejaan), adalah dokumen yang memerintahkan bank membayar ejumlah wang tertentu dari akaun orang kepada orang yang namanya cek itu dikeluarka...

Cue vs. Queue - Apa perbezaannya?

Monica Porter

Mungkin 2024

Cue (kata benda)Tindakan atau peritiwa yang menjadi iyarat untuk eeorang melakukan euatu.Cue (kata benda)Kata-kata terakhir pertunjukan pelakon bermain, berfungi ebagai intimai untuk pelakon eterunya ...

Penerbitan Yang Popular